We are planning a car show for Aug. 13th at Brews and Cues. Brews and Cues is located on 6823 Rochdale Bvld. The registration fee will be $10 for early bird(before July 30th) or $15 after July 30th. There will be an awesome prize draw for the early bird entries. The show will run from 12:00 - 5:00 with prizes being given out at 5:30. From 8:00 on all those that are of legal drinking age are welcome to head into Brews and Cues for the beers part of the show. There will be many prizes at the show as well as models and a car wash. With parts of proceeds going to a charity. E-mail kowalykm@gmail.com with pictures of your car as well as your name and a list of modifications done to it. If you do not have a picture you can swing by the shop (1001 Winnipeg street in Regina, Sask) and we will take pictures of it for you. We are currently looking for sponsors to provide door prizes or whatever else they can do to help out with this show, if you are interested in sponsoring it contact contact@cubed.ca.
